8 arts groups to get $2.8m in funds from NAC
The grants will be a help for established and emerging groups
Eight arts groups here will be getting a $2.77 million boost from the National Arts Council (NAC) in its bid to support both emerging and existing arts groups.
The funds can go towards supporting the operations of younger arts organisations, while established groups can use the money to improve the quality and reach of their programmes.
The NAC will commit $350,000 to these organisations for the rest of the financial year, which ends on March 31 next year, and will support them to the tune of $2.42 million in total for the next three years.
The Seed Grant scheme, which was launched in June this year, attracted over 30 applications, of which Maya Dance Theatre, Paper Monkey Theatre, Nine Years Theatre, Orchestra of the Music Makers, Singapore Music Society, New Opera Singapore, Grey Projects and Art Incubator were selected. Each group will get between $20,000 and $75,000 for this financial year.
